How LIMS Transforms Data Management in Pathology Labs

How LIMS Transforms Data Management in Pathology Labs

Pathology labs are fundamental in healthcare, tasked with analyzing patient samples and providing critical data for diagnosis. However, managing vast quantities of data efficiently can be challenging without the right tools. That’s where Laboratory Information Management Systems (LIMS) come in. LIMS software helps pathology labs streamline their operations, ensuring faster, more accurate data management. Streamlined Sample Tracking

Managing a large number of patient samples, each with different histories and test requirements, can be overwhelming. Without a system in place, the risk of misplaced or improperly identified samples rises. LIMS simplifies sample tracking by assigning unique identifiers (barcodes or RFID tags) to each sample as it enters the lab. This ensures that every sample is correctly linked to its corresponding data, from collection through to analysis and final reporting.

Automated Data Entry and Validation

Manual data entry is time-consuming and prone to human errors. LIMS automates this process by capturing data directly from laboratory instruments and integrating it into the system. For example, when a sample is tested, LIMS automatically imports the test results, removing the need for lab staff to manually input the data. This results in more accurate records and significant time savings.

Moreover, LIMS can validate data in real-time, ensuring that test results fall within expected ranges. If any results fall outside normal parameters, the system can flag them for review, reducing the chances of erroneous reports being issued.

Efficient Data Access and Reporting

One of the standout features of LIMS is its ability to provide real-time access to critical patient data. Lab technicians, pathologists, and healthcare providers can access test results, sample information, and patient histories instantly, regardless of their location. This streamlined data access improves decision-making, reduces wait times, and enhances collaboration among medical professionals.

LIMS also simplifies the process of generating and sharing reports. Once test results are processed, the system can automatically generate detailed reports that can be sent to relevant healthcare professionals. These reports are standardized, reducing the chances of misinterpretation and ensuring that all necessary information is included.

Compliance and Regulatory Adherence

Pathology labs must comply with various industry regulations, including HIPAA, CLIA, and ISO standards. Managing compliance manually can be a daunting task, but LIMS makes this process much easier. The system automatically logs all actions, creating an audit trail that can be used to demonstrate compliance during inspections or audits. Additionally, LIMS ensures that all data is stored securely and in accordance with regulatory requirements.

Improving Workflow and Reducing Turnaround Time

Pathology labs operate in high-pressure environments where speed and efficiency are critical. By automating routine tasks, LIMS reduces bottlenecks and improves overall workflow. For example, when a sample arrives at the lab, LIMS automatically logs it and assigns it to the appropriate technician or test. As the sample moves through different stages of processing, LIMS keeps track of its status and updates the team in real-time.

This level of automation significantly reduces the time it takes to process a sample, from receipt to final report. As a result, labs can handle higher volumes of samples in less time, reducing turnaround times and improving service delivery.

Data Integrity and Accuracy

Accuracy is paramount in pathology labs, as even a small error can lead to incorrect diagnoses and potentially harm patients. LIMS helps maintain data integrity by ensuring that all information is consistently and accurately recorded. The system can also verify that test results are consistent with established medical standards, alerting lab staff if any results are outside the normal range.
